Nomad welcomes editor Matthew Hilber

LOS ANGELES - Nomad (www.nomadedit.com) recently added Matthew Hilber to its roster of editors. He brings experience  working on projects that range from heartfelt and resonant to outright hilarious. 

As a Portland-native, Hilber began his career at Joint, Wieden+Kennedy’s editorial arm, where he worked for 15 years, cutting spots for Nike, Coca-Cola, Old Spice and KFC. Highlights include a TurboTax Super Bowl commercial starring Humpty Dumpty, and “Tough Love” for P&G, which aired during the Paralympic Games and won a Cannes Silver Lion. His recent credits include Emmy-winning spots for Fox Sports, Chili’s, Amazon, Lowe’s and State Farm. He has also collaborated on long-form projects for Laika, Facebook and Hurst.

“I’ve been fortunate enough to be surrounded by great people over the course of my career, and this was an opportunity to reunite with some of the best,” he says of his signing with Nomad. 

In addition to LA, Nomad has locations in New York, London, Austin and Tokyo.
